Being a clown isn’t all fun and games. Rodeo clowns expose themselves to great danger every time they perform. When cowboys dismount or are bucked off of bulls at riding competitions, rodeo clowns jump in front of the bulls and motion wildly to get their attention. In this way rodeo clowns provide an alternate target, and in doing so protect the rider. So you see, sometimes clowning around can be serious business. What is the main idea of this passage?
The main idea of this passage is that rodeo clowns protect cowboys by putting themselves in danger.

Marie Curie not only the first woman to have won a Nobel Prize, she is also the only person to win a Nobel Prize in two different sciences. Most notably, however, Marie Curie discovered radiation. She was also the first person to use radiation to treat tumors. Curie experimented extensively with radioactivity during her scientific career. Unfortunately the damaging effects of radiation were not known then. Her exposure to radiation most likely was the cause of her blindness and early death. Still today her scientific papers are considered too dangerous to handle without protective equipment. These documents are stored in lead-lined boxes. Even her cookbook is radioactive. She must have made some really hot food in her lifetime. What was the main idea of this passage?
The main idea of the passage is that Marie Curie did amazing work with radiation that caused her health problems later.

It’s hard to imagine what things were like before there was money, but such a time did exist. During these times people exchanged goods using the barter system. The word barter means to trade. People using the barter system traded things instead of buying and selling them. So if you were a rice farmer, you would trade your rice with many people to get all of the things that you wanted or needed. Unfortunately, the people from whom you needed things might not want your rice. Isn’t it nice to just go to the store and buy candy instead of having to trade rice for it? What is the main idea of this passage?
The main idea of this passage is that before money people would use the barter system.

What’s that humming sound? Could it be hummingbird, the only bird capable of backward flight? Hummingbirds have many unique flight habits that distinguish them from other birds. Most birds flap their wings up and down to fly, but the hummingbird moves its wings forward and backward very rapidly in a figure eight pattern. This allows the hummingbird to hover in position, fly upside down, and move about very rapidly. And while other birds have to push off with their feet to begin flying, and work their ways up to their top speeds, the hummingbird can both start flying at maximum speed and stop flying instantaneously. After you’ve seen a hummingbird in flight, it’s unlikely that you’ll mistake them for another bird. What is the main idea of this passage?
The main idea of this passage is that hummingbirds fly in a totally unique and unusual way.

There are four stages of the butterflies life cycle: The first stage is the egg. Butterfly eggs are small and round. The second stage is a caterpillar. Caterpillars are born very small and must eat the leaf that they are born on to grow. The third stage is a pupa or chrysalis. Within the chrysalis the old body parts of the caterpillar are undergoing a remarkable transformation, called metamorphosis. The fourth stage is a butterfly. The caterpillar emerges from the chrysalis as a beautiful butterfly. What is happens after the egg stage in the butterflies life cycle?
After the egg stage, the caterpillar is born.
